Murchison falls national park
The 10 Amazing Days of Wildlife and Primate Trekking Safari in Uganda will take you first to Murchison falls national park which is the most visited and biggest national park in Uganda with over 451 bird species and then over 67 species of mammals. The park is only 5 hours away from Kampala and has got several gates at the entrance. The park offers a lot of attractions including boat cruises and a game drive where you will see animals such as kobs, elephants, giraffes, lions, and crocodiles and have a view of the powerful waterfalls called Murchison falls found within the park.
Kibale Forest National park
This safari will take you to Kibale Forest National Park which is referred to as the primate’s capital of Africa. The park has got over 14 primate species and it covers 795 square kilometers. Here visitors will have an opportunity to meet the chimpanzees and other primates, and be able to participate in chimpanzee trekking activities where they will be able to see habituated chimpanzees within the forest. Visitors can also engage in a chimpanzee habituation experience in Kibale Forest national park in addition to birding and guided walks to explore the unexploited Bigodi wetland which is around Kibale Forest National Park.
Bwindi Impenetrable National park
Gorilla trekking is the most sought-after activity by visitors taking safaris in Uganda and Africa in general. The 10 Amazing Days of Wildlife and Primate Trekking Safari in Uganda will take you to Bwindi Impenetrable Forest National Park in southwestern Uganda which harbors more than half of the world’s mountain gorillas. The park is valuable and it has got over 19 habituated gorilla families that are available for gorilla trekking by visitors. There are 4 gorilla trekking regions of Bwindi that include Rushaga, Ruhija, Nkuringo, and Buhoma and all these are available for trekking, visitors can as well engage in a gorilla habituation experience in Bwindi which gives them four hours of seeing the gorillas.
Queen Elizabeth National park
As we are still exploring Uganda, the Safari will take you to Queen Elizabeth National Park which is known for its wildlife, including African buffalo, Ugandan kob, hippopotamus, giant forest hog, warthog, Nile crocodile, African bush elephant, African leopard, tree-climbing lions, and chimpanzees. It is home to 95 mammal species and over 500 bird species. The area around Ishasha in Rukungiri District is famous for its tree-climbing lions, whose males sport black manes.
Lake Mburo National Park
Lake Mburo National Park is where you will enjoy the game drives and be able to spot leopards, zebras white-tailed mongooses among others. Visitors will get a chance to take a boat cruise on Lake Mburo and see a variety of animals including hippos crocodiles, side-stripped jackals, leopards, hyenas, and antelopes along with site different bird species. Other attractions and activities for your 2 wonderful days of the great tour to Lake Mburo National Park include the Rubanga forest walks, visiting the salt lick, horseback riding, nature guided walks safaris, and quad biking to sport the game among others.
